1. Where is my company's information stored?
All of our software is web-based, and is therefore hosted on HireGround's servers. Can we have our information stored on our own servers? Yes. Is there an extra cost for what? Yes. Please Contact us for more information.
2. What kind of laws govern my information protection and your information protection policy?
Since we, and our servers, are located in Canada, all of the information stored in those servers are protected under the Canadian PIPEDA and FOIP laws protecting the privacy and information of both your company and your candidates.
3. Could you give me a breakdown of your servers?
The server machines: our central servers run on Dell server machines. These servers have redundant disks and redundant power supplies to maximize possible uptime. Along with an excellent reputation of Dell's quality is 24x7x365 service contract, meaning if the worst should happen someone will be fixing the problem no matter what time of day it is.
The server technology: all web components are served by load balanced servers running the newest version of the Apache web server. Apache serves more web sites than all other web server environments combined. For security, performance, reliability, flexibility, and cost (ROI) we serve our sites exclusively using Apache.
The operating system: the servers run on the Linux operating system due to its outstanding security, performance, reliability, and flexibility. HireGround stands among companies like Google, Boeing, IBM, DaimlerChrysler, and Sony that also use Linux for their critical services.
The infrastructure: At the core of the network is a managed Cisco Catalyst switch. This critical network infrastructure is backed by Cisco's reputation for intelligent network security and performance.
The database: Our redundant databases run PostgreSQL. We use PostgreSQL because it delivers enterprise-class performance, scalability, and flexibility, with platform agnostic deployment and Open Source licensing. Organizations that depend on PostgreSQL include the U.S. Centers for Disease Control, Apple, Safeway, Fujitsu, and Cisco.

6. What kind of network do you use?
The network itself is housed in an enterprise-grade data center located in Calgary, Alberta. The secure nature of the data centre restricts physical access, and the climate control system guarantees sufficient hardware cooling. The fire prevention system is designed to protect all equipment from loss of data.
6. How often do you back up my information? Can I access that backed up information later?
To ensure availability of all services, all web and database content is mirrored over multiple physical servers. HireGround also backs up the databases and software to office servers daily. Backup files are available for download at any time using the Corporate Solutions Administration Centre.
7. What kind of security measures do you have in place to protect my company's data and candidates that apply?
All our services, no matter how small, are monitored constantly by a remote agent. If anything should go down, even for a minute, alerts are sent out and response teams are assembled to resolve the issue. All websites are served through the secure socket layer (SSL). SSL is the industry standard for encrypting web content and protecting the integrity and privacy of data transferred from the servers to other computers.
